Parameter: Lifetime
Default: 1800
Options: A value specifying the number of seconds
Function: Specifies the maximum length of time that the advertised addresses are to
be considered as valid router addresses by hosts, in the absence of further
advertisements.
Instructions: Specify a value that is no less than the value you set for the Maximum
Interval parameter and no greater than 9000 seconds.
MIB Object ID: 1.3.6.1.4.1.18.3.5.3.2.1.17.1.8
Parameter: Interface Preference
Default: 0
Options: A numeric value
Function: Specifies the preferability (a higher number indicates more preferred) of
the address as a default router address, relative to other router addresses
on the same subnet.
Instructions: Enter a value indicating the relative preferability of the router address.
Enter a preference value of 0x80000000 to indicate to neighboring hosts
that the address is not to be used as a default route.
MIB Object ID: 1.3.6.1.4.1.18.3.5.3.2.1.17.1.9
Configuring Blacker Front End Support
Configuring BFE support on an IP interface requires you to
Configure an X.25 interface that conforms to the BFE requirements described
in this section.
Enable the IP routing protocol on the interface.
Enable RIPSO support on the interface.
Before you begin the procedures described in this section, we recommend that
you have the following guides available for reference:
Configuring Routers
The appropriate protocol manual
